Windstream Communications

>
>
>
El Paso

Windstream Communications stores & openning hours in El Paso

Windstream Communications - El Paso

4110 Rio Bravo St, El Paso, TX 79902

Windstream Communications locations & hours near El Paso

81 miles

Windstream Communications - Sierra Blanca

450 E Walling St, Sierra Blanca, TX 79851
196 miles

Windstream Communications - Jal

214 S 3rd St, Jal, NM 88252

Windstream Communications - Texas

Number of stores: 29
State: Texas change state



Windstream Communications jobs in Texas